In this paper, a system for measuring flow of pedestrians using a stereo camera is proposed. The system does not need adjustment after installation and its installation environment is not restricted. The proposed method consists of two stages, i.e., estimation process and measurement process. Estimation process automatically estimates parameters that are typically adjusted manually after installation by using images and distance information obtained from a stereo camera. Measurement process measures flow of pedestrians using one of the two methods, i.e., particle filter and a method using KLT and Voronoi. The selection is performed depending on the congestion level of the pedestrians. The proposed method is evaluated through experiments for four scenes that are typical in real operation.
